Abstract

A coaxial TEM horn was designed on the basis of results from nonstationary computer modeling using code KARAT. With its high dielectric strength, this antenna is capable of radiating high-power ultrawideband nanosecond pulses. The pulse source used was a compact generator built around a coaxial forming line with a built-in Tesla transformer, which shapes pulses up to 1 GW high at repetition frequencies up to 1 kHz. The amplitude of the pulses on a matched load was 20 kV at a duration of 4 nsec. Returns of ultrawideband signals from objects with simple geometric shapes were studied in laboratory experiments using this radiator.
